Job 5:13
►
He catches the wise in their craftiness, and sweeps away the plans of the cunning.

Parallel Verses
NASB:
"He captures the wise by their own shrewdness, And the advice of the cunning is quickly thwarted.
KJV:
He taketh the wise in their own craftiness: and the counsel of the froward is carried headlong.
